To receive Supports Coordination or funding for services within the context of the ODP Intellectual Disability System, registration with the County Intellectual Disability system is essential. This process typically involves providing necessary documentation and information about the individual's needs and situation to establish eligibility for support services.

Being registered with the County Intellectual Disability system allows individuals to access the resources, services, and supports that are tailored to meet their unique circumstances. It ensures that assessments can be conducted, and personalized support plans can be developed. This registration process acts as a foundational step in connecting individuals to the services they require, facilitating appropriate coordination of care and funding.

While feedback surveys, family recommendations, and participation in community programs may provide additional context or support, they do not serve as prerequisites for receiving Supports Coordination or services. Therefore, registration with the County Intellectual Disability system stands out as the necessary initial step to access the relevant support and funding.
